# Bumper
A standalone implementation of the central server used by Ecovacs Deebot cleaning robots to relay data between the robot and client.

If this isn't an option, you'll need to configure your router DNS to point a number of domains used by the app/robot to the Bumper server.
**Note:** Depending on country, your phone may be using a different domain. Most of these domains contain country-specific placeholders.
**Note:** Depending on country, your phone may be using a different domain. Most of these domains contain country-specific placeholders. We'll work to document all domains we encounter, but there may be additional domains and the preferred method is a overriding the full domains as above.
- Example: If you see `eco-{countrycode}-api.ecovacs.com` and you live in the US/North America you would use: `eco-us-api.ecovacs.com`
| Address | Description |
@ -62,8 +60,13 @@ If this isn't an option, you'll need to configure your router DNS to point a num
| `lb-{countrycode}.ecovacs.net` | Load-balancer that is checked by the app/robot |
| `eco-{countrycode}-api.ecovacs.com` | Used for Login |
| `portal-{countrycode}.ecouser.net` | Used for Login and Rest API |
| `portal-ww.ecouser.net` | Used for various Rest APIs |
| `msg-{countrycode}.ecouser.net` | Used for XMPP |
| `mq-ww.ecouser.net` | Used for MQTT |
| `gl-{countrycode}-api.ecovacs.com` | Used by Ecovacs Home app for API |
| `recommender.ecovacs.com` | Used by Ecovacs Home app |
